Identification |
Name: | Methanone,[4-(dimethylamino)phenyl]phenyl- |
Synonyms: | Benzophenone,4-(dimethylamino)- (6CI,7CI,8CI); 4-(Dimethylamino)benzophenone;4-(Dimethylamino)phenyl phenyl ketone; 4-Benzoyl-N,N-dimethylaniline;N,N-Dimethyl-p-aminobenzophenone; NSC 15962; NSC 28935;p-Benzoyl-N,N-dimethylaniline |
CAS: | 530-44-9 |
EINECS: | 208-478-4 |
Molecular Formula: | C15H15 N O |
Molecular Weight: | 225.29 |
InChI: | InChI=1/C15H15NO/c1-16(2)14-10-8-13(9-11-14)15(17)12-6-4-3-5-7-12/h3-11H,1-2H3 |

Properties |
Flash Point: | 141.2°C |
Boiling Point: | 250 °C / 15mmHg |
Density: | 1.096g/cm3 |
Stability: | Stable under normal temperatures and pressures. |
Refractive index: | 1.6 |
Water Solubility: | insoluble |
Solubility: | insoluble |
Appearance: | Yellow crystals |
Specification: |
4-(Dimethylamino)benzophenone (CAS NO.530-44-9), its Synonyms are Benzophenone, 4-(dimethylamino)- (8CI) ; Methanone, (4-(dimethylamino)phenyl)phenyl- ; p-Benzoyl-N,N-dimethylaniline ; p-Dimethylaminobenzophenone ; 4-Dimethylaminobenzophenone ; 4-N,N-Dimethylaminobenzophenone . It is yellow crystalline powder or crystals.
